The Surge in Shrapnel Injuries and the Search for Minimally Invasive Solutions

As drone warfare and advanced weaponry escalate in modern conflicts, frontline medics face a new epidemic: shrapnel wounds. In Ukraine, military doctors report that up to 80% of battlefield injuries now involve shrapnel—much of it embedded dangerously close to vital organs. Traditional extraction methods are invasive, risky, and time-consuming. Magnetic Extraction Devices: A Game-Changer in War Medicine

The introduction of magnetic shrapnel extractors is rewriting the protocols of emergency surgery in Ukraine and capturing international attention. These devices, often pen-shaped and tipped with high-strength magnets, enable surgeons to quickly locate and remove ferrous fragments through tiny incisions. Benefits include:

  • Rapid removal with reduced bleeding
  • Smaller, less invasive cuts than traditional surgery
  • Increased survival rates, especially in cases involving the heart, lungs, or abdomen

Dr. Serhiy Maksymenko and his team have conducted over 70 successful heart operations with these tools, marking a major leap in trauma care. Certification, Safety, and the Ethics of Emergency Innovation

One FAQ from medical communities and the general public alike: Are these magnetic devices certified? Are they safe? Under martial law, Ukraine has bypassed standard certification processes to save lives on the battlefield, sparking debates in the international medical community. FAQs

Q: How do magnetic shrapnel extractors work?
A: They draw ferrous fragments to the tip, allowing removal through a small incision—less risky than traditional surgery.

Q: Are these devices used outside Ukraine?
A: They are being considered by medics in other war zones; civilian adoption may follow pending further studies.

Q: What risks remain?
A: As with any non-certified device, there are risks, but urgent needs in war often outweigh regulatory concerns.
